Output 21c285008e4634d749dfde51e303be74a402c5f5a13f2f35335a5129871b109b:88

value
16900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d0254c40eab1ebdd755f4e0662511f2ae2f48a OP_EQUAL
address
3R1dagDRiVjURBauv8VK3TRBzteEeZRMsx
transaction
21c285008e4634d749dfde51e303be74a402c5f5a13f2f35335a5129871b109b
confirmations
408946
spent
true